Gabriel Martim
14 十一月 2024
Spark 检查点问题:为什么即使添加检查点后错误仍然存​​在

当使用重新分区命令的 Spark 作业仍然因与洗牌相关的问题而失败时,即使在实施检查点之后遇到持续的 Spark 故障也可能会非常烦人。 Spark 对 shuffle 阶段的处理以及成功打破 RDD 沿袭的困难常常是导致此错误的原因。在这里,我们研究如何构建强大的 Spark 作业,通过将检查点与持久性策略、复杂的配置和单元测试相结合,可以有效地处理数据,同时降低失败风险。 🚀